Transaction e2bc0176e330ada317f5fc205600fdfae7eed4f355df1f63aec8b6094632eeac
1 Input
1 Output
-
e2bc0176e330ada317f5fc205600fdfae7eed4f355df1f63aec8b6094632eeac:0
- value
- 786491
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c0ff0238398ec178e166f707a2ea03d325a7db5
- address
- bc1qls8lqgurnrkp0rskdac85t4q85e95ld4ganl26